Apple’s strong sales momentum for the MacBook Neo, its new $599 entry-level laptop powered by the A18 Pro chip and released in March 2026, underpins the 95.7% market-implied odds against discontinuation. The model quickly became a bestseller with over a million units shipped in its first weeks, positive reviews highlighting solid performance, battery life, and accessibility for students and first-time Mac buyers, plus ongoing supply constraints and plans for an A19 Pro refresh in 2027. Traders see little reason for Apple to halt sales of a product expanding its Mac audience and contributing to record first-time buyer numbers. While sudden regulatory shifts, major supply disruptions, or an unexpected full lineup overhaul could theoretically intervene, no verified developments point to such risks in the near term.
